Prediction and head to head Varvara Gracheva vs. Clara Burel
There is no head to head record between Varvara Gracheva and Clara Burel since this will be the first time that they will fight against each other in the main tour.

Clara Burel
Ranked no. 144 (career-high), will start her run in Strasbourg after she won the title in the Gaudens after beating 6-2 1-6 6-2 Dulgheru in the final.
Clara has an overall 18-6 win-loss record in 2021, 9-2 on clay (See FULL STATS).
The French player won her last 5 matches.
In terms of her career, Burel has an overall 64-38 record. She has a positive 34-22 record on clay.
